Common air conditioning issues in Metro West, FL

  • Frequent short cycling or no cooling — often caused by dirty coils, clogged filters, or failing capacitors.
  • High humidity and condensation problems — typical in Central Florida and frequently tied to poor airflow, undersized systems, or clogged drain lines.
  • Uneven temperatures across rooms — airflow restrictions, duct leaks, or improper system sizing.
  • Reduced efficiency and rising energy bills — due to aging equipment, low refrigerant, or dirty components.
  • Strange noises or odors — indicating loose parts, failing motors, or mold in the condensate pan/ducts.
  • Refrigerant leaks and R-22 concerns — older systems using R-22 refrigerant face higher service costs and availability issues.

Diagnostic process: how a technician identifies the issue

  1. Start with symptoms and history: when the problem began and any recent events (storms, power outages).
  2. Visual inspection: outdoor unit, coil condition, refrigerant lines, and condensate drain.
  3. Electrical checks: voltage and amperage testing to detect failing motors or components.
  4. Refrigerant and pressure testing: measure charge and check for leaks.
  5. Airflow and temperature split measurement: determine if airflow or heat exchange is working properly.
  6. IAQ screening: check filters, humidity, and signs of mold or dust.
  7. Duct evaluation: inspect for leaks or poorly insulated ducts contributing to heat gain.
  8. Recommendation: repair options, efficiency improvements, or replacement assessment with estimated energy impacts.

Repair versus replacement: making the right choice in Metro West, FL

Deciding between repair and replacement depends on several factors:

  • System age: units older than 10-15 years are often less efficient and more prone to costly failures.
  • Frequency and cost of repairs: repeated major repairs suggest replacement is more economical.
  • SEER and energy costs: higher-SEER modern systems deliver significant savings in hot, humid climates.
  • Refrigerant type: systems using R-22 may be candidates for replacement due to refrigerant phase-out and cost.
  • Comfort goals: if humidity control or whole-home IAQ improvements are priorities, a new system with better dehumidification or advanced filtration may be worth it.Use a simple rule of thumb: if a repair exceeds 50% of the value of a new system and the unit is over a decade old, replacement should be strongly considered.

Indoor air quality checks and solutions for Metro West homes

High humidity, pollen, and organic growth are common IAQ problems in Metro West, FL. Typical checks and improvements include:

  • Filter upgrades (MERV-rated or HEPA options for specific needs)
  • Whole-house dehumidifiers to reduce mold and musty smells
  • UV coil purifiers to limit microbial growth on the evaporator coil
  • Media air cleaners or electronic air cleaners for particle reduction
  • Proper ventilation and sealing to reduce outdoor pollutant entry

Smart thermostat setup and optimization in Metro West, FL

A professionally installed smart thermostat does more than remote control. Proper setup includes:

  • Confirming compatibility with your HVAC system type (heat pump staging, multi-stage compressors)
  • Wiring verification and safe integration with safety controls
  • Humidity control configuration to prevent indoor moisture problems
  • Smart scheduling aligned to local weather patterns and your comfort preferences
  • Calibration and sensor placement to avoid false readings from direct sunlight or heat sources

Preventive maintenance tips for Metro West, FL homeowners

  • Replace or clean filters every 1-3 months (more often during allergy season)
  • Keep outdoor condenser units free of debris and shaded when possible
  • Clear and inspect condensate drains to prevent clogs and water damage
  • Maintain attic and duct insulation to reduce heat gain
  • Schedule professional tune-ups before peak summer to catch small issues early
